请注意,我是新手,所以这对您来说可能是一个简单的问题。无论如何,我有 6 个超链接,我想将它们放置在两个垂直列中,每列三个。您不必写出整个代码,只需为我指明正确的方向,以获得完成此任务的最有效途径,谢谢!提供图片
问问题
66 次
2 回答
3
您可以在一个容器内有 2 个无序列表,并使用float
它并排放置,或者您也可以使用display: inline-block;
,但最好坚持使用浮动,像这样
HTML
<div class="wrap">
<ul>
<li><a href="#">one</a></li>
<li><a href="#">two</a></li>
<li><a href="#">three</a></li>
</ul>
<ul>
<li><a href="#">one</a></li>
<li><a href="#">two</a></li>
<li><a href="#">three</a></li>
</ul>
</div>
CSS
.wrap {
overflow: hidden;
}
.wrap ul {
float: left;
margin-right: 50px;
}
于 2013-04-26T06:10:46.610 回答
0
对 Mr.Alien 代码进行了改进:
.wrap {
overflow: hidden;
}
.wrap ul {
float: left;
margin-left: 50px;
}
.wrap ul:first-child {
margin-left: 0;
}
于 2013-04-26T07:16:07.963 回答